Description

RPS6KB1, also known as ribosomal protein S6 kinase beta-1 isoform a, is a serine/threonine kinase that acts downstream of PIP3 and phosphoinositide-dependent kinase-1 in the PI3 kinase pathway. Phosphorylation of S6 induces protein synthesis at the ribosome. The phosphorylation of p70S6K at threonine 389 has been used as a hallmark of activation by mTOR and correlated with autophagy inhibition in various situations. However, several recent studies suggest that the activity of p70S6K plays a more positive role in the increase of autophagy. Recombinant human RPS6KB1, fused to His-tag at C-terminus, was expressed in insect cell and purified by using conventional chromatography techniques
